From ff534bc2fe9a4f25923fa1ffbdb114a7fa4d2907 Mon Sep 17 00:00:00 2001 From: Andreas Schneider Date: Tue, 5 Nov 2019 08:50:12 +0100 Subject: [PATCH] cmake: Use target_include_directories() Signed-off-by: Andreas Schneider Reviewed-by: Anderson Toshiyuki Sasaki (cherry picked from commit 5e2788d4c54de203e0fa5a6c9253e93c2836bd01) --- src/CMakeLists.txt | 9 ++++----- 1 file changed, 4 insertions(+), 5 deletions(-) diff --git a/src/CMakeLists.txt b/src/CMakeLists.txt index 0c153ad3..1a2036f0 100644 --- a/src/CMakeLists.txt +++ b/src/CMakeLists.txt @@ -295,11 +295,6 @@ if (NOT WITH_NACL) endif (NOT HAVE_OPENSSL_ED25519) endif (NOT WITH_NACL) -include_directories( - ${LIBSSH_PUBLIC_INCLUDE_DIRS} - ${LIBSSH_PRIVATE_INCLUDE_DIRS} -) - # Set the path to the default map file set(MAP_PATH "${CMAKE_CURRENT_SOURCE_DIR}/${PROJECT_NAME}.map") @@ -336,6 +331,8 @@ target_compile_options(${LIBSSH_SHARED_LIBRARY} PRIVATE ${DEFAULT_C_COMPILE_FLAGS} -D_GNU_SOURCE) +target_include_directories(${LIBSSH_SHARED_LIBRARY} + PRIVATE ${LIBSSH_PUBLIC_INCLUDE_DIRS} ${LIBSSH_PRIVATE_INCLUDE_DIRS}) target_link_libraries(${LIBSSH_SHARED_LIBRARY} PRIVATE ${LIBSSH_LINK_LIBRARIES}) @@ -390,6 +387,8 @@ if (BUILD_STATIC_LIB) ${DEFAULT_C_COMPILE_FLAGS} -D_GNU_SOURCE) + target_include_directories(${LIBSSH_STATIC_LIBRARY} + PRIVATE ${LIBSSH_PUBLIC_INCLUDE_DIRS} ${LIBSSH_PRIVATE_INCLUDE_DIRS}) target_link_libraries(${LIBSSH_STATIC_LIBRARY} PUBLIC ${LIBSSH_LINK_LIBRARIES})